Transaction 3014cfaf82933773401d9ff526cf4ba54e692c598e3d63592e54150bdc26c2a0
1 Input
1 Output
-
3014cfaf82933773401d9ff526cf4ba54e692c598e3d63592e54150bdc26c2a0:0
- value
- 13199852
- script pubkey
- OP_0 OP_PUSHBYTES_20 fd6f58f44d75c8b4a63885dc05fa5a3e96289922
- address
- bc1ql4h43azdwhytff3cshwqt7j686tz3xfzn33qfw